Against the backdrop of hills, the beaches of Phuket are one of the most sought after palm-fringed tropical destinations in the world and it’s easy to see why – powder soft sand, clear water, reefs within swimming distance.

There are countless beaches in Phuket, ranging from the hugely popular (and crowded) Patong, Kata and Karon beaches to the more secluded Nai Han Beach on the southern tip or Kamala on the west coast. Phuket is home to some of the most renowned golf clubs in the world, including the award-winning Blue Canyon Country Club, Mission Hills Golf Resort and Red Mountain Golf Course. Each has it’s own particular challenges, and all are set against stunning natural backdrops.

You can try out many different water sports in Phuket – catch a breeze while windsurfing, go sailing or kayaking and explore nearby beaches and islands or go diving and snorkeling in the crystal clear waters of the Andaman. The coastal waters are especially rich in shoals of brightly colored fish and exotic coral formations.

 

Why not take a day to explore the Similan Islands, a national park that contains beautiful unspoilt islands and forests and some of the most renowned and well- preserved coral reefs in the world. Consistently ranked as one of the top ten dive locations in the world, there are over 20 documented dive sites and you’ll see countless colourful tropical fish and possibly even a manta or whale shark.
